So, why is this whole **Kubernetes** service-to-service communication security thing so crucial? Well, imagine your Kubernetes cluster as a bustling city. You have all these services, like little shops, interacting with each other to provide the overall experience to your users. Some of these services handle sensitive data – user credentials, financial information, you name it. If the communication between these services isn't secure, it's like leaving the doors of those shops wide open. Anyone who can get inside your Kubernetes network could potentially eavesdrop on or even tamper with the data being exchanged. And that's where the problems really start! In a **microservices** architecture, services often depend on each other, so a vulnerability in one service can quickly spread to others. A compromised service can be used as a stepping stone to access other services and data within the cluster. Secure communication helps you prevent lateral movement by attackers. By securing service-to-service communication, you're not just protecting individual services; you're protecting the entire ecosystem. This means you're creating a more secure environment for your applications, reducing the risk of breaches, and improving the overall trust in your systems. It also helps you meet compliance requirements, such as those for handling sensitive data. So, securing this communication is not just a nice-to-have; it's a must-have.
